Opened 6 years ago

Closed 6 years ago

Last modified 6 years ago

#56663 closed defect (fixed)

octave-devel @4.5.0+_3: liboctave.5.dylib: No such file or directory

Reported by: ryandesign (Ryan Carsten Schmidt) Owned by: MarcusCalhoun-Lopez (Marcus Calhoun-Lopez)
Priority: Normal Milestone:
Component: ports Version:
Keywords: Cc:
Port: octave-devel

Description

octave-devel fails in the post-destroot block:

https://build.macports.org/builders/ports-10.13_x86_64-builder/builds/28084/steps/install-port/logs/stdio

DEBUG: Executing proc-post-org.macports.destroot-destroot-0
xinstall: mkdir /opt/local/var/macports/build/_opt_bblocal_var_buildworker_ports_build_ports_math_octave/octave-devel/work/destroot/opt/local/lib/octave/4.x.x
DEBUG: system: install_name_tool -id /opt/local/lib/octave/4.x.x/liboctave.5.dylib /opt/local/var/macports/build/_opt_bblocal_var_buildworker_ports_build_ports_math_octave/octave-devel/work/destroot/opt/local/lib/octave/4.5.0+/liboctave.5.dylib
error: install_name_tool: can't open file: /opt/local/var/macports/build/_opt_bblocal_var_buildworker_ports_build_ports_math_octave/octave-devel/work/destroot/opt/local/lib/octave/4.5.0+/liboctave.5.dylib (No such file or directory)
Command failed: install_name_tool -id /opt/local/lib/octave/4.x.x/liboctave.5.dylib /opt/local/var/macports/build/_opt_bblocal_var_buildworker_ports_build_ports_math_octave/octave-devel/work/destroot/opt/local/lib/octave/4.5.0+/liboctave.5.dylib
Exit code: 1

The file liboctave.5.dylib was created earlier, but in a directory called 5.0.0, not 4.5.0+:

libtool: install: /usr/bin/install -c liboctave/.libs/liboctave.5.dylib /opt/local/var/macports/build/_opt_bblocal_var_buildworker_ports_build_ports_math_octave/octave-devel/work/destroot/opt/local/lib/octave/5.0.0/liboctave.5.dylib
libtool: install: (cd /opt/local/var/macports/build/_opt_bblocal_var_buildworker_ports_build_ports_math_octave/octave-devel/work/destroot/opt/local/lib/octave/5.0.0 && { ln -s -f liboctave.5.dylib liboctave.dylib || { rm -f liboctave.dylib && ln -s liboctave.5.dylib liboctave.dylib; }; })

Change History (2)

comment:1 Changed 6 years ago by Marcus Calhoun-Lopez <marcuscalhounlopez@…>

Resolution: fixed
Status: assignedclosed

comment:2 Changed 6 years ago by MarcusCalhoun-Lopez (Marcus Calhoun-Lopez)

Thank you for noticing this.

Note: See TracTickets for help on using tickets.